About the Role
Based at Duchy College, we are looking for an experienced individual to teach elements of our land and environment programmes. We are particularly looking for someone from the industry with experience or qualifications across a range of agricultural practices. Experience/knowledge of land-based machinery experience, especially agricultural machinery would also be advantageous.
Skills & Experience
You do not have to be a qualified lecturer as we will put you through the necessary training. Ideally, applicants must have a minimum 2 years' post qualifying experience of working in the industry and have experience of working with students and/or volunteers. The successful applicant must provide a positive, fun and safe experience for all learners enrolled that enables them to achieve to their maximum potential.
Benefits
- Generous annual leave schemes: 42 days* per annum for teaching roles (pro-rata for part-time), plus a paid Christmas closure of two weeks for most roles. *37 days annual leave at commencement of employment, increasing to 42 days after successful completion of probationary period.
- Access to generous occupational pension schemes for teachers and support staff.
- Flexible and supportive family friendly working practices.
- A range of staff development activities available and all employees have access to free tuition on many of our courses.
- A range of health and wellbeing initiatives to our employees including access to free counselling and a corporate eye care scheme.
- Employee discount scheme via a corporate benefit scheme - discounts with major retailers.
- Most of our campus sites offer free parking to employees as well as discounted restaurants and salons.
